**Handover: Burrowcache bloom filter**

Hey, welcome aboard! Quick note before I'm out: the bloom filter sitting in front of the Burrowcache KV store cuts useless lookups way down, but it needs a rebuild whenever false-positive rates creep up. There's a weekly job for that. The filter's current runtime configuration is pasted below.

config for kafof-bawef:
holath:
  log_level: debug
  metrics_host: metrics.holath.qorvelsys.internal
  pin: 2191
  pool_size: 32

## Releases

Welcome aboard. This section exists because of the Quillhaven stale-cache incident: a release went out with an old dependency lockfile baked in, and cached manifests masked the mismatch for three days. Since then, every release is built from a clean checkout, the cache is purged before packaging, and artifacts carry a content digest that downstream nodes verify independently. Please follow the checklist in order and don't reuse build directories. Each finished artifact must be signed prior to upload with the key below.

rollout seal: bky13_Mi5bKzEWhnsFq

Digest scheduling runs through the Mailloft batch queue at 06:00 UTC. If digests stall, check the Pincord scheduler for stuck cron entries before restarting workers. Never re-enqueue a partially sent batch; dedupe first via the ledger check job. Manual re-triggers go through the Mailloft admin endpoint, which requires authentication, so include the key below.

API key for tagef-fafop: vxb2-ta

Hey, handing over the Pennywharf public API pagination work. We moved from offset pagination to cursor tokens in v3 — offsets still work but are capped at 10k rows, which is what most support tickets are about. Tell customers to switch to the next_cursor field; tokens expire after an hour, so stale-token errors are expected, not a bug. The v2 endpoints are frozen and get sunset next quarter. If someone reports missing rows, check their page size against the limits. The relevant configuration values follow.

deployment values, bahof-badug:
[rusix]
team = zorok
access_code = ac_641cbe
owner = ulair.tamius
host = rusix.torvasoft.local
port = 5672
peer = ulaix.sivrelworks.internal
salt = 1df570ed
pin = 6327